The Honeywell R7284U-1004 is a universal electronic oil primary control featuring a 16-character, two-line tri-lingual LCD for easy programming and diagnostics. It offers programmable parameters without the need for extra tools, and status/fault alerts via LED or display. Compact and lightweight, this reliable Honeywell model is designed for seamless integration and efficient oil burner management.

Replaced an old analog honeywell oil primary with this. It was easy to replace for me however I have some experience and technical background. So far it works just like it should and I like the information I can get from it compared to my old one. For example: CAD cell resistance measurement as well as average measurement, number of cycles, number of failed ignition attempts, time to ignition last cycle and average and more. Its also nice that you can program this to shut off the ignition after the burner starts. I guess it would save some electricity since its not powering the transformer all the time when the burner is running but for some reason the burner runs quieter with the ignition off. I can hear quite clearly the rumble get much quieter once the ignition shuts off after 5 seconds or so.I cant comment on how long this unit will last though. Its fairly simple so it should hold up. Replaced R8184G 4009 Perfectly! (after a little trial and error)
I replaced a failed R8184G 4009 with this unit, and this works perfectly.I replaced the R8184G on my Beckett oil furnace with this for several reasons:1. R8184G failed.2. R8184G wasn't available locally within 3 days in the dead of winter. Even my local heater technician didn't have one on hand. If he *WOULD HAVE* had it, he would have charged me over $500 to install this unit!! (It took about 10 minutes to install and 30 minutes of trial and error to get the menu settings correctly configured)3. This was actually CHEAPER!4. I could get this delivered in about 14 hours, ordering it at 6:30PM on Monday night. It arrived by 8AM the next morning. With free Prime shipping.Since the R8184G is a 3-wire unit, this took a little figuring out to hook it up correctly, then some more figuring to set the menu up correctly.Wiring:Black AND red wire on R7284 connected to where the black wire used to go on my R8184.White wire on R7284 went where white wire used to go on R8184.Orange wire on R7284 went where red wire used to go on R8184.Yellow CAD wires on R7284 went to same yellow wires that were connected to the front of the R8184.My thermostat wires from the front of the R8184 went to the front TT terminals on the R7284.Menu settings:I originally tried to use some of the new fancy settings on the R7284. If upgrading from the R8184, don't try to use those settings. You would have to change the wiring for it to work. It caused me several hard lockouts to learn this lesson.Final working menu settings:Valve On Delay: 0 secondsIgnition time: 45 seconds matches the R8184G. THIS one you can change if you prefer.Burner Off Delay: 0 secondsTT Configured: NoSpark In On Dly: NoSpark During Run: NoAllowed Resets: Your choiceAppliance Type: FURN (for my oil furnace)Show Diagnostics: Your choiceInstaller Setup: QuitRe-Baseline: YesIt's working perfectly for me and I have blessed heat again. The replacement was very easy once I figured all the connections and settings out.

This R7284U-1004 control is a nice improvement over the old Honeywell R8184G primary control I had previously on our oil fired boiler. Installation was fairly easy, except that I needed to pull another single #14 THHN wire through the flexible metal conduit that runs to the burner junction box to provide a constant 120V power supply to this new control, which is in addition to the existing switched 120V line from the boiler control itself. I think that might be an issue for some if they want to DIY this control install, but other than that, the rest of the installation seems pretty straight forward. The customizable settings and status/error code display are great features to have, so I think it was well worth the extra work involved for installing this control.
